 This is the best release of swMenuFree yet with many new features and enhancements.
Create a dynamic popout menu module for your site using either the trans or myGosu menu systems. Choise of menu systems provides for greater template compatability and configuration options.
Advanced menu source features for the menu now include the ability to automatically create whole menu structures from content(content only menu), Or too automatically append content items as menu items to existing section and category tables or blogs(hybrid Menu). This unique system of menu and content integration allows you to custom make a menu system that automatically updates itself as content is added. Virtuemart integation is also supported for sites with this installed.
Create and export external style sheet and edit it manually for unlimited styling capabilities and 100% XHTML compliance and validation. swMenuFree now includes manual and automatic style sheet editors.
Active menu feature will automatically keep the top menu item highlighted for the part of the site being viewed.
Cache feature makes for better server performance on busy sites.
Conditional module placement lets you add another element for showing modules. Specify a template, component, or langusge that must be true for the menu module to display.
Integrated update/repair facility makes it easy to upgarde to future versions of swMenuFree without losing any settings.
Trans menu can now have left opening submenus or submenus that slide up.

Awesome menu system for someone like me who is just above being css illiterate, but does want some customization! I tried a few of the other menu systems, and settled on this one. I got things working last night much easier than I could have imagined, and am ecstatic over the results. I wanted to be able to use the menu buttons that I'm already using in the Solarflare II template. This menu system made this super easy
This did require a tiny bit of knowledge of an image editing program (Paint Shop Pro in my case), but only because of how Solar Flare template has the button images done. The button image and mouseover images in Solar Flare II are a single png image file (top half has one button, the bottom half of the image has the mouseover button). I just needed to cut each half of the image file and paste each as its own image, and then upload those two files to my server.
The component then creates a module for you, and you go in and fill in the parameters. All I had to do was, in the proper box in the form, point to the new image files I uploaded. I had to do some tweaks like change the font size, etc., but all this is done in the component without requiring any knowledge of css.
